SKF stock closed at SEK 268.60 on Nasdaq Stockholm on September 16, 2026, up about 1.0% for the session based on data from Nasdaq Stockholm and Yahoo Finance. The gain came on a day when the OMXS30 benchmark index climbed 0.98% to 3,250.63, signaling that SKF tracked the broader Swedish equity market higher.

Today’s drivers and events

Today, September 17, 2026, investors approach the open without a scheduled earnings release from SKF, with the next reporting date for the company’s quarterly results indicated as October 21, 2026 after the market close by an earnings calendar from eToro. Broader market sentiment today is likely to be influenced by developments around the Federal Reserve’s policy meeting and reactions in major global indices, which can affect industrial and cyclical stocks such as SKF through changes in interest rate expectations and growth outlook. In addition, an extraordinary general meeting of AB SKF is scheduled for October 1, 2026, as highlighted in a notice carried by PR Newswire, which may draw attention in the coming weeks as shareholders prepare for corporate decisions.
